最近,我在網(wǎng)站開發(fā)中遇到了一個非常棘手的問題——CSS已停止工作。在網(wǎng)站加載時,所有的CSS樣式都消失了,導致網(wǎng)站的樣式和排版極為混亂。
我第一時間檢查了CSS文件的位置和路徑,但是一切看起來都沒有問題。然后,我想到可能是CSS文件本身出了問題。于是,我打開了CSS文件查看,但是在文件中并沒有發(fā)現(xiàn)任何錯誤。
body { font-family: 'Helvetica Neue',Helvetica,Arial,sans-serif; font-size: 16px; line-height: 1.5; } h1, h2, h3, h4, h5, h6 { font-family: 'Helvetica Neue',Helvetica,Arial, sans-serif; font-weight: normal; margin-top: 0; margin-bottom: .5rem; }
接著,我開始懷疑是服務器出了問題,于是我聯(lián)系了服務器管理員,查看了服務器日志。但是,服務器并沒有出現(xiàn)任何問題。
最后,我開始逐個檢查HTML文件,發(fā)現(xiàn)在HTML文件中我不小心把CSS文件的鏈接刪除了。于是,一旦HTML文件中缺少CSS文件的鏈接,CSS樣式就無法生效了。
為了避免這種問題的發(fā)生,我會在編寫HTML文件時仔細檢查CSS文件的鏈接是否正確,確保樣式能夠正常加載。此外,在開發(fā)網(wǎng)站時,及時備份CSS文件也是非常重要的。
上一篇css左下角圖片
下一篇css左右晃動的標簽